Army Corps is a combined arms unit of the Ukrainian Ground Forces. It was formed in September 2016, acting as a reserve corps and designated as the Strategic Reserve of the Ukrainian Armed Forces. Following the Russian full-scale invasion of Ukraine, the corps underwent a significant transformation and transitioned into a regular standard army&#8230;<\/p>","protected":false},"author":1,"featured_media":51146,"parent":11750,"menu_order":0,"template":"","meta":{"_kad_blocks_custom_css":"","_kad_blocks_head_custom_js":"","_kad_blocks_body_custom_js":"","_kad_blocks_footer_custom_js":"","_kad_post_transparent":"","_kad_post_title":"","_kad_post_layout":"","_kad_post_sidebar_id":"","_kad_post_content_style":"","_kad_post_vertical_padding":"","_kad_post_feature":"","_kad_post_feature_position":"","_kad_post_header":false,"_kad_post_footer":false,"_kad_post_classname":"","footnotes":""},"unit_tag":[742],"class_list":["post-22606","unit","type-unit","status-publish","has-post-thumbnail","hentry","unit_tag-district"],"taxonomy_info":{"unit_tag":[{"value":742,"label":"Limited Tabs"}]},"featured_image_src_large":["https:\/\/militaryland.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/08\/499682517_1020355580279207_2160070210849301741_n.jpg",960,380,false],"author_info":{"display_name":"Jerome Rendall","author_link":"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ua\/author\/ml_admin\/"},"comment_info":"","related_losses":false,"related_posts":[{"ID":31059,"post_title":"Ukrainian Army reforms the Reserve Corps","post_content":"<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Ukrainian command has decided to reform the strategic reserve of the Ukrainian Army and form 11th Army Corps on its basis.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:more -->\n<!--more-->\n<!-- \/wp:more -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The Reserve Corps, initially established in 2016 as the strategic reserve of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, underwent a significant shift following the full-scale Russian invasion in February 2022. With the loss of its original purpose, the reserve force transitioned into functioning as a standard army corps. Against this backdrop, the decision to formalize the creation of the 11th Army Corps is not only logical but also anticipated. The change was announced on via the official social media channels.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The 11th Army Corps is composed of four mechanized brigades, one artillery brigade, and one tank brigade.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->","post_excerpt":"","post_author":"1","post_date":"2024-05-06 21:56:43","post_date_gmt":"2024-05-06 20:56:43","post_status":"publish","comment_status":"open","ping_status":"closed","post_password":"","post_name":"the-army-has-reformed-reserve-corps","to_ping":"","pinged":"","post_modified":"2024-05-08 20:55:56","post_modified_gmt":"2024-05-08 19:55:56","post_content_filtered":"","post_parent":0,"guid":"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/?p=31059","menu_order":0,"post_type":"post","post_mime_type":"","comment_count":"0","comments":false,"_thumbnail_id":["31061","1","2024-05-06 21:41:11","2024-05-06 20:41:11","60th Mechanized Brigade","news_11armycorps","","inherit","open","closed","","news_11armycorps","","","2024-05-06 21:41:28","2024-05-06 20:41:28","","31059","https:\/\/militaryland.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/05\/news_11armycorps.webp","0","attachment","image\/webp","0","31061"],"category":[{"term_id":"3","name":"\u041d\u043e\u0432\u0438\u043d\u0438","slug":"news","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"3","taxonomy":"category","description":"","parent":"0","count":"1057","object_id":"83442","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"3"}],"post_tag":false,"post_format":false,"id":31059},{"ID":38929,"post_title":"Armed Forces Eye Transition to 'Corps-Brigade' System","post_content":"<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>By the end of November, the Armed Forces of Ukraine will present a reform concept that will transition the military to a corps-based system, <a href=\"https:\/\/www.ukrinform.ua\/rubric-society\/3930086-zsu-planuut-perejti-na-korpusnu-sistemu.html\">Ukrinform<\/a> reports, citing sources within the army. These corps will be structured around experienced brigades and their commanders, granting them increased responsibility and autonomy.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The Armed Forces of Ukraine currently have six corps: the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/9th-army-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"22604\">9th<\/a>, <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/10th-army-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"22021\">10th<\/a>, <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/11th-army-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"22606\">11th<\/a>, and <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/12th-army-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"38811\">12th Army Corps<\/a>, along with the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/air-assault-forces\/7th-air-assault-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"26772\">7th Rapid Response Corps<\/a> of the Air Assault Forces and the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/ukrainian-navy\/30th-marine-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"29805\">30th Marine Corps<\/a> of the Navy.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Yuriy Butusov, the editor-in-chief of Ukrainian Censor.net, shared new details about the ongoing transformation of the Armed Forces of Ukraine during his regular <a href=\"https:\/\/www.youtube.com\/watch?v=ufsCbC7-ixY\">Butusov Live<\/a> show on YouTube. According to Butusov, the command intends to establish up to 20 Army Corps to scale up the top brigades and build new forces around them. Each corps will be assigned a specific area of responsibility and will oversee at least five brigades.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>All existing corps will be restructured into combat corps, no longer serving solely as administrative units in the rear. The Operational Strategic Groups (OSUV), Operational Tactical Groups (OTU), and Tactical Groups (TG) will be disbanded, with the corps eventually assuming control of the frontlines. <\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The 30th Marine Corps will undergo a complete reform, as it currently functions primarily as an administrative body, with marine units scattered across the entire frontline. Additionally, the marines will receive extra staffing, as some units have yet to recover since the Krynky Operation. The 7th Rapid Reaction Corps of the Air Assault Forces will be split into two corps, as the current structure is too large.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/column {\"borderWidth\":[\"\",\"\",\"\",\"\"],\"uniqueID\":\"42365_80ae60-44\",\"kbVersion\":2,\"metadata\":{}} -->\n<div class=\"wp-block-kadence-column kadence-column42365_80ae60-44\"><div class=\"kt-inside-inner-col\"><!-- wp:html -->\n<script async src=\"https:\/\/pagead2.googlesyndication.com\/pagead\/js\/adsbygoogle.js?client=ca-pub-1294996283912605\"\n     crossorigin=\"anonymous\"><\/script>\n<ins class=\"adsbygoogle\"\n     style=\"display:block; text-align:center;\"\n     data-ad-layout=\"in-article\"\n     data-ad-format=\"fluid\"\n     data-ad-client=\"ca-pub-1294996283912605\"\n     data-ad-slot=\"1699389936\"><\/ins>\n<script>\n     (ad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({});\n<\/script>\n<!-- \/wp:html --><\/div><\/div>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/column -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"42365_fdfcc2-20\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ading42365_fdfcc2-20 w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ading42365_fdfcc2-20\">New Corps formations<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>According to Yuriy Butusov, the <strong>3rd Assault Brigade<\/strong> will be restructured into the 3rd Army Corps. Each corps will generally consist of approximately five mechanized brigades, an artillery brigade, and specialized units for air defense, engineering, reconnaissance, communications, and unmanned systems operations.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Below is a list of all known corps, including some that have not been officially confirmed but have been revealed through various sources.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:block {\"ref\":48512} \/-->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"47543_7779ae-32\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ading47543_7779ae-32 w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ading47543_7779ae-32\">National Guard<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The National Guard of Ukraine has formed two army corps based on two high-performing units\u2014the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/national-guard\/azov-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"11913\">12th Azov Brigade<\/a> and the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/national-guard\/khartia-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"18810\">13th Khartia Brigade<\/a>. Although the National Guard includes many other units, there are currently no plans to establish additional corps formations.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:html -->\n<div class=\"list-units-pods\">[pods name=\"unit\" orderby=\"ukrainian_short_name.meta_value_num\" where=\" ID IN ('45530','45538')\" template=\"Units List News post\" limit=\"100\"][\/pods]<\/div>\n<!-- \/wp:html -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"47543_bc260a-7e\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ading47543_bc260a-7e w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ading47543_bc260a-7e\">Ground Forces<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The Ground Forces serve as the primary branch for the formation of army corps. Currently, twelve army corps formations are known, with an additional three to five expected to be established. According to information obtained by MilitaryLand, these new corps are likely to continue the existing numerical designation sequence.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:html -->\n<div class=\"list-units-pods\">[pods name=\"unit\" orderby=\"ukrainian_short_name.meta_value_num\" where=\" ID IN ('44237','22604','22021','22606','38811','444088','45088','44410','45090','44412','45507','45510','44408')\" template=\"Units List News post\" limit=\"100\"][\/pods]<\/div>\n<!-- \/wp:html -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>One of the corps formations is expected to include the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/24th-mechanized-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"11783\">24th Mechanized Brigade<\/a>, the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/54th-mechanized-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"15736\">54th Mechanized Brigade<\/a>, and the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/56th-motorized-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"14142\">56th Motorized Brigade<\/a>. However, not all brigades will be incorporated into the corps structure\u2014some will remain under the direct command of the General Staff or the Ground Forces Command. According to sources from MilitaryLand, the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/19th-missile-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"16631\">19th Missile Brigade<\/a> is one such example.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"47543_e2164f-39\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ading47543_e2164f-39 w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ading47543_e2164f-39\">Naval Forces<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The Naval Forces of Ukraine currently have one corps\u2014the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/ukrainian-navy\/30th-marine-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"29805\">30th Marine Corps<\/a>, commanded by Maj. Gen. Dmytro Delyatsky. Despite comprising four marine brigades, three coastal defense brigades, and two artillery brigades\u2014making it the largest corps in the Defense Forces by number of units\u2014there are no plans to establish additional corps within the Naval Forces.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:html -->\n<div class=\"list-units-pods\">[pods name=\"unit\" orderby=\"ukrainian_short_name.meta_value_num\" where=\" ID IN ('29805')\" template=\"Units List News post\" limit=\"100\"][\/pods]<\/div>\n<!-- \/wp:html -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"47543_d1585a-88\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ading47543_d1585a-88 w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ading47543_d1585a-88\">Territorial Defense Forces<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>According to <a href=\"https:\/\/www.pravda.com.ua\/articles\/2025\/04\/30\/7509779\/\">Ukrainska Pravda<\/a> and earlier reports, the Ukrainian Command plans to establish at least one additional army corps.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"47543_a94cb8-e2\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ading47543_a94cb8-e2 w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ading47543_a94cb8-e2\">Air Assault Forces<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Before the transition to the corps system, the Air Assault Forces operated a single corps\u2014the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/air-assault-forces\/7th-air-assault-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"26772\">7th Rapid Reaction Corps<\/a>. As part of the reorganization, a second formation was introduced: the 8th Air Assault Corps, built around the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/air-assault-forces\/82nd-airassault-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"18618\">82nd Air Assault Brigade<\/a>.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:html -->\n<div class=\"list-units-pods\">[pods name=\"unit\" orderby=\"ukrainian_short_name.meta_value_num\" where=\" ID IN ('26772','46677')\" template=\"Units List News post\" limit=\"100\"][\/pods]<\/div>\n<!-- \/wp:html -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Each corps will be assigned a designated zone of responsibility, typically covering a 50 to 70 kilometer stretch. Brigadier General Serhiy Sirchenko, who simultaneously commanded both OTU Luhansk and the 11th Army Corps, will continue leading operations in the same area \u2014 the frontline around Chasiv Yar and Siversk \u2014 now under the direct control of the 11th Army Corps.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Similarly, the 9th Army Corps, led by Major General Viktor Nikolyuk \u2014 who also simultaneously commanded OTU Donetsk \u2014 is taking over responsibility for the same operational area near Pokrovsk, one of the hottest and hottest sectors of the front.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Subordinate tactical groups, including Toretsk, Pokrovsk, and Velyka Novosilka, have also been disbanded as part of the wider structural shift.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>According to <a href=\"https:\/\/www.pravda.com.ua\/\">Ukrainska Pravda<\/a>, OTU Kharkiv and OTU Starobilsk continue to operate under the previous format.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"58246_dc825f-8b\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ading58246_dc825f-8b w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ading58246_dc825f-8b\">Tactical Groups<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Operational Tactical Units (OTUs) and Tactical Groups are temporary command structures within the Ukrainian Defense Forces, established in response to Russia\u2019s full-scale invasion. They were created to oversee and coordinate troops operating directly in combat zones and surrounding areas. Their authority is limited to the forces deployed within their assigned areas of responsibility. The structure and role of these units were explored in detail by MilitaryLand in the article \u201c<a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/news\/the-role-of-tactical-groups-and-corps-in-the-armed-forces\/\">The Role of Tactical Groups and Corps in the Armed Forces<\/a>,\u201d published in November last year.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->","post_excerpt":"","post_author":"1","post_date":"2025-07-30 12:34:51","post_date_gmt":"2025-07-30 10:34:51","post_status":"publish","comment_status":"open","ping_status":"closed","post_password":"","post_name":"defense-forces-disband-two-tactical-groups","to_ping":"","pinged":"","post_modified":"2025-08-09 22:42:51","post_modified_gmt":"2025-08-09 20:42:51","post_content_filtered":"","post_parent":0,"guid":"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/?p=58246","menu_order":0,"post_type":"post","post_mime_type":"","comment_count":"0","comments":false,"_thumbnail_id":["58544","1","2025-07-30 08:23:05","2025-07-30 06:23:05","","news_otudisband","","inherit","open","closed","","news_otudisband","","","2025-07-30 08:23:05","2025-07-30 06:23:05","","58246","https:\/\/militaryland.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/07\/news_otudisband.webp","0","attachment","image\/webp","0","58544"],"category":[{"term_id":"3","name":"\u041d\u043e\u0432\u0438\u043d\u0438","slug":"news","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"3","taxonomy":"category","description":"","parent":"0","count":"1057","object_id":"83442","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"3"},{"term_id":"4","name":"\u041e\u0434\u0438\u043d\u0438\u0446\u0456","slug":"units","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"4","taxonomy":"category","description":"","parent":"0","count":"384","object_id":"83442","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"4"}],"post_tag":[{"term_id":"1142","name":"\u0410\u0440\u043c\u0456\u044f","slug":"army","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"1142","taxonomy":"post_tag","description":"","parent":"0","count":"296","object_id":"82851","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"1142"}],"post_format":false,"id":58246},{"ID":58251,"post_title":"Progress and Challenges in the Corps Transformation","post_content":"<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>In June 2025, the transformation of the Defense Forces into a corps\u2011and\u2011brigade system entered its final phase as corps formations gradually assumed control of the front. Meanwhile, the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/11th-army-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"22606\">11th Army Corps<\/a> has taken over responsibility from the disbanded <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/tactical-group-luhansk\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"35630\">Operational Tactical Group Luhansk<\/a> and will now oversee the Chasiv Yar and Siversk sectors.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:block {\"ref\":48512} \/-->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"58251_c33a56-3a\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ading58251_c33a56-3a w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ading58251_c33a56-3a\">Still a Long Way to Go<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:quote -->\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\"><!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p><em>\u201cOut of the 11 brigades operating within the corps' area, only three are actually ours.\"<\/em><\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ph --><\/blockquote>\n<!-- \/wp:quote -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Most of the brigades under corps command are not structurally subordinated to the corps, as a full reorganization of the front is currently impossible. At the same time, new corps-level units\u2014such as drone teams, reconnaissance elements, and engineering detachments\u2014are being formed from the remnants of other, already existing brigades.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p><em>\u201cOut of the 11 brigades operating within the corps' area, only three are actually ours,\u201d<\/em> one officer told <a href=\"https:\/\/www.pravda.com.ua\/articles\/2025\/07\/28\/7523689\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Ukrainska Pravda<\/a>. <em>\u201cIn the corps\u2019 fire support unit, only half the personnel are artillerymen\u2014the rest are officers, engineers, and topographers. Our drone battalion is being formed from a rifle battalion of one of the brigades. They have neither drones nor any experience in operating them.\u201d<\/em><\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The use of temporarily assigned units follows the same system that the previous tactical and operational-tactical groups operated under\u2014and has proven to be ineffective.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Another challenge is that units belonging to a single corps are currently spread out along the frontline. For instance, the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/national-guard\/1st-azov-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"45530\">1st Azov Corps<\/a> has the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/national-guard\/azov-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"11913\">Azov Brigade<\/a> positioned south of Kostyantynivka, temporarily under the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/19th-army-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"45090\">19th Army Corps<\/a>' command, while the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/national-guard\/bureviy-brigade\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"17478\">Bureviy Brigade<\/a> is deployed near Kupyansk\u2014over 100 kilometers apart.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The situation is somewhat different with the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/3rd-army-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"44237\">3rd Army Corps<\/a>, which is among the strongest and most motivated formations within the Defense Forces.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p><em>\u201cThis is purely political. Biletsky holds too much authority, and the military leadership is doing everything they can to delay the deployment of his corps,\u201d<\/em> a source told <a href=\"https:\/\/www.pravda.com.ua\/articles\/2025\/07\/28\/7523689\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Ukrainska Pravda<\/a>.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Despite the challenges, the <a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/ukraine\/armed-forces\/3rd-army-corps\/\" data-type=\"unit\" data-id=\"44237\">3rd Army Corps<\/a> continues to steadily assume control of the frontline in the Lyman direction and has already demonstrated positive results. Unlike the Tactical Group Kreminna, which previously held this sector, the 3rd Army Corps command does not pressure units to retake lost positions at all costs. Instead, they carefully assess the situation and are willing to make decisions that genuinely save soldiers\u2019 lives.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->","post_excerpt":"","post_author":"1","post_date":"2025-07-30 20:54:43","post_date_gmt":"2025-07-30 18:54:43","post_status":"publish","comment_status":"open","ping_status":"closed","post_password":"","post_name":"progress-and-challenges-in-the-corps-transformation","to_ping":"","pinged":"","post_modified":"2025-08-10 10:22:43","post_modified_gmt":"2025-08-10 08:22:43","post_content_filtered":"","post_parent":0,"guid":"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/?p=58251","menu_order":0,"post_type":"post","post_mime_type":"","comment_count":"0","comments":false,"_thumbnail_id":["58602","1","2025-07-30 20:24:06","2025-07-30 18:24:06","","news_corps_update","20th Army Corps","inherit","open","closed","","news_corps_update","","","2025-09-15 22:01:56","2025-09-15 20:01:56","","58251","https:\/\/militaryland.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/07\/news_corps_update.webp","0","attachment","image\/webp","0","58602"],"category":[{"term_id":"698","name":"\u041f\u0443\u0431\u043b\u0456\u043a\u0430\u0446\u0456\u044f","slug":"article","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"698","taxonomy":"category","description":"","parent":"0","count":"47","object_id":"82851","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"698"},{"term_id":"4","name":"\u041e\u0434\u0438\u043d\u0438\u0446\u0456","slug":"units","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"4","taxonomy":"category","description":"","parent":"0","count":"384","object_id":"83442","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"4"}],"post_tag":[{"term_id":"1142","name":"\u0410\u0440\u043c\u0456\u044f","slug":"army","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"1142","taxonomy":"post_tag","description":"","parent":"0","count":"296","object_id":"82851","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"1142"}],"post_format":false,"id":58251},{"ID":59001,"post_title":"Veteran Brigades Join 11th Army Corps","post_content":"<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The 11th Army Corps, the oldest active formation in the Ukrainian Army, has recently undergone a significant reorganization. This is where the update\u2019s most significant inaccuracies appear.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The T-64BM2 6TD was operated only by the 92nd Assault Brigade (then the 92nd Mechanized Brigade) in 2022; that brigade is absent from the in-game unit selection. In 2022, the 92nd fielded two companies of these tanks, so including the platform without its historical operator creates a factual inconsistency.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Similarly, the BTR-4E was primarily operated by the 92nd Brigade in 2022, while most BTR-4 variants at the time were in service with the National Guard. Although the 58th Motorized Brigade operates a small number of BTR-4Es today, that was not the case in 2022.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Even rarer systems, such as the Bastion-01 and BMP-1TS, were not in use with regular Armed Forces of Ukraine frontline units in 2022. These platforms were confined to training centers; when the full-scale invasion began, they were removed from training stocks and handed over to the first units that arrived \u2014 not fielded as standard equipment by combat brigades.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Conversely, several common vehicles that were widespread in 2022 are missing from the faction. The T-64BV, one of the most common tanks in Ukrainian service, does not appear in the game. The BTR-3 \u2014 used by units such as the 95th Air Assault Brigade, which is featured in the update \u2014 is also absent.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The other units included in the faction \u2014 the 10th Mountain Assault Brigade, 28th Mechanized Brigade, 58th Motorized Brigade, 148th Artillery Brigade, and 35th Marine Brigade \u2014 primarily used Soviet-era equipment and Ukrainian MRAPs, such as the Kozak-2, during the 2022 period. These are represented more accurately in the update.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->","post_excerpt":"","post_author":"1","post_date":"2025-11-12 21:07:11","post_date_gmt":"2025-11-12 20:07:11","post_status":"publish","comment_status":"open","ping_status":"closed","post_password":"","post_name":"ukrainian-faction-in-squad-all-mistakes-listed","to_ping":"","pinged":"","post_modified":"2025-11-12 21:07:13","post_modified_gmt":"2025-11-12 20:07:13","post_content_filtered":"","post_parent":0,"guid":"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/?p=68205","menu_order":0,"post_type":"post","post_mime_type":"","comment_count":"0","comments":false,"_thumbnail_id":["69645","1","2025-11-12 20:39:15","2025-11-12 19:39:15","","news_squad","","inherit","open","closed","","news_squad","","","2025-11-12 20:39:15","2025-11-12 19:39:15","","68205","https:\/\/militaryland.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/10\/news_squad.webp","0","attachment","image\/webp","0","69645"],"category":[{"term_id":"698","name":"\u041f\u0443\u0431\u043b\u0456\u043a\u0430\u0446\u0456\u044f","slug":"article","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"698","taxonomy":"category","description":"","parent":"0","count":"47","object_id":"82851","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"698"},{"term_id":"4","name":"\u041e\u0434\u0438\u043d\u0438\u0446\u0456","slug":"units","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"4","taxonomy":"category","description":"","parent":"0","count":"384","object_id":"83442","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"4"}],"post_tag":[{"term_id":"1142","name":"\u0410\u0440\u043c\u0456\u044f","slug":"army","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"1142","taxonomy":"post_tag","description":"","parent":"0","count":"296","object_id":"82851","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"1142"},{"term_id":"1157","name":"\u0443\u043a\u0440\u0430\u0457\u043d\u0430","slug":"ukraine","term_group":"0","term_taxonomy_id":"1157","taxonomy":"post_tag","description":"","parent":"0","count":"100","object_id":"82851","term_order":"0","pod_item_id":"1157"}],"post_format":false,"id":68205},{"ID":74861,"post_title":"Commanders of 10th and 54th Brigades Dismissed","post_content":"<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>Following the rapid loss of the city of Siversk, north of Bakhmut, Ukraine\u2019s senior military command has removed the commanders of two brigades from their posts: Colonel Oleksiy Konoval, commander of the 54th Mechanized Brigade, and Colonel Volodymyr Potyeshkin, commander of the 10th Mountain Assault Brigade. This was reported by <em><a href=\"https:\/\/www.pravda.com.ua\/news\/2025\/12\/27\/8013612\/\">Ukrainska Pravda<\/a><\/em>, citing sources within the Defense Forces.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The 54th Mechanized Brigade was responsible for the direct defense of Siversk, while the 10th Mountain Assault Brigade was positioned to the south of the city. An inspection team has also been dispatched to the headquarters of both brigades.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>According to <em><a href=\"https:\/\/www.pravda.com.ua\/news\/2025\/12\/27\/8013612\/\">Ukrainska Pravda<\/a><\/em>, the dismissals were prompted by false reports submitted by both brigades regarding the state of defenses around Siversk and the situation on the battlefield. These discrepancies came to light only after the city had been lost.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>In addition, the 11th Army Corps\u2014under which both brigades were temporarily subordinated\u2014has had its area of responsibility reduced. In its place, a temporary formation, Tactical Group Soledar, has been re-established. The tactical group is commanded by Brigadier General Denys Maistrenko, head of the 169th Training Center. According to <em>Ukrainska Pravda<\/em>, the headquarters of the 11th Army Corps had trusted the leadership of the 54th and 10th Brigades, and routine inspections had failed to reveal any problems.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>The commander of Task Force East, Brigadier General Dmytro Bratishko, under whose authority the 11th Army Corps operates, reacted angrily upon learning of the loss of Siversk. He demanded that the Ukrainian flag be raised over the city \u201cat any cost.\u201d Subsequently, a flag was carried by a drone and placed on a railway station building in Siversk. According to the report, this action had no operational significance and served only as a symbolic gesture.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/advancedheading {\"uniqueID\":\"74861_edd45b-82\",\"markBorder\":\"\",\"markB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"tabletM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}],\"mobileMarkBorderStyles\":[{\"top\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"right\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"bottom\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"left\":[null,\"\",\"\"],\"unit\":\"px\"}]} -->\n<h2 class=\"kt-adv-heading74861_edd45b-82 wp-block-kadence-advancedheading\" data-kb-block=\"kb-adv-heading74861_edd45b-82\">From the trenches<\/h2>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/advancedheading -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>According to relatives and servicemen from the brigades deployed around Siversk, both units are severely depleted and have received almost no reinforcements, as newly mobilized personnel are being redirected to assault units in the south.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:paragraph -->\n<p>At the same time, Russian forces have intensified drone activity and air strikes in the Siversk area, rendering many Ukrainian defensive positions vulnerable. A sergeant from one of the brigades operating in the sector said that multiple KAB guided bombs are being used against Ukrainian positions every day, penetrating even deeply dug fortifications. Rotations are conducted exclusively on foot. Soldiers deployed to frontline positions report going without sleep for several days due to constant pressure and the lack of relief.<\/p>\n<!-- \/wp:paragraph -->\n\n<!-- wp:kadence\/image {\"align\":\"center\",\"id\":74868,\"imgMaxWidth\":513,\"sizeSlug\":\"medium_large\",\"link\":\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/605780344.jpg\",\"linkDestination\":\"media\",\"uniqueID\":\"74861_77f98f-f7\"} -->\n<div class=\"wp-block-kadence-image kb-image74861_77f98f-f7\"><figure class=\"aligncenter size-medium_large\"><a href=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/605780344.jpg\" class=\"kb-advanced-image-link\"><img src=\"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/605780344-768x1024.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"kb-img wp-image-74868\"\/><\/a><figcaption><em>Ukrainian positions near Siversk, 2025<\/em><\/figcaption><\/figure><\/div>\n<!-- \/wp:kadence\/image -->","post_excerpt":"","post_author":"1","post_date":"2025-12-27 22:10:19","post_date_gmt":"2025-12-27 21:10:19","post_status":"publish","comment_status":"open","ping_status":"closed","post_password":"","post_name":"commanders-of-10th-and-54th-brigades-dismissed","to_ping":"","pinged":"","post_modified":"2025-12-27 22:20:40","post_modified_gmt":"2025-12-27 21:20:40","post_content_filtered":"","post_parent":0,"guid":"https:\/\/militaryland.net\/?p=74861","menu_order":0,"post_type":"post","post_mime_type":"","comment_count":"3","comments":[{"comment_ID":"15788","comment_post_ID":"74861","comment_author":"MaxDiak","comment_author_email":"maximterminator@gmail.com","comment_author_url":"","comment_author_IP":"2a02:586:b81a:7579:24bd:40ef:40fd:c0e6","comment_date":"2025-12-28 21:19:46","comment_date_gmt":"2025-12-28 20:19:46","comment_content":"The 54th had held positions east of siversk quite effectively for a lot of time before this collapse.
